SQL Database Administrator- Work from home

Greater Salt Lake City Area, US - Computer Hardware, Computer Software, Information Technology and Services

Job Description



We are looking for a talented individual to join our Enterprise Tools Support team working with Dell Services customers supporting the Project Development - Tools Support Team. Individuals will have the opportunity to work in a professional atmosphere, with different project teams, and with the latest Database technologies. Our team members work remotely from their home office, with up to 5% travel to customer sites. This position can be a remote/home based position with travel to the client sites as required.



The Database Advisor - will evaluate customer SQL and Oracle database requirements and develop optimal solutions to address their needs. The consultant will be able to document designs, configurations and project results. Provide hands-on delivery of production deployment and migration. In addition, this person support, the development of databases, help train team members, support all databases and storage operationally, support Migrations (Unix to Linux), consolidations and upgrades projects. The Database Administrator will provide knowledge transfer to internal team members, customer technical staff as well as provide technical briefings to customer management.



Role Responsibilities

*Evaluate customer database requirements and develop optimal solutions to address their needs

*Document designs, configurations and project results

*Provide hands-on delivery of production deployment and migration

*Participate in database deployments, Migrations (Unix to Linux), consolidations and upgrades projects

*Provide System Administration Support as directed.

*A consultative approach to develop, present and explain the value of proposed infrastructure solutions to customers

*Perform a wide variety of technical and administrative duties in overall enterprise solution assessment, design, validation, development, delivery and ongoing support

*Candidate will work in a highly decentralized and customer facing environment



Required Skills



*Very strong SQL skills with demonstrated experience migrating and upgrading databases.

*The role requires both broad and deep technology knowledge to architect solutions by mapping a customer's business problem to an end-to-end technology solution

* The Consultant should possess a strong knowledge of Linux operating system setup and configuration required to support an Oracle database infrastructure (MS Windows OS is Optional)

* Working level knowledge of Oracle database required.

* The following Database skills are required:

SQL 2008 through 2012.

*Design , development and administration of databases

*Performance monitoring, reporting and database tuning

*Reviewing and tuning of SQL & PL/SQL code using explain plans

*Individual should have a mix of advanced technology and practical operational acumen

*Strong analytical and communications skills, as well as the ability to resolve complex technical problems



Desired Skills



*Experience using migration tools such as Quest and Goldengate, etc.

*Familiar with other databases like DB2, My SQL and SQL Server

*Familiar with Solaris, AIX, HPUX

*Familiar with virtualization technologies such as VMWare and Oracle Virtual Server

*Knowledgeable about various Storage products



Education



SQL certification



Experience



Typically requires at least 8 years relevant experience without a Degree; 3+ years relevant experience with Undergraduate Degree; 2+ years relevant experience with Graduate Degree
